Maxine Greer lives and works in Porthleven, Cornwall. She creates sculptures and drawings inspired by the natural world. She is currently Artist In Residence at Kota Restaurant, Porthleven working with Chef Jude Kereama exploring and recording what’s in season through painting and drawing.
She has exhibited in numerous solo and group shows in the UK and internationally and was awarded the People’s Choice Award at Peterborough Museum for her ‘Flock’, an installation of over 200 paper sparrows, in 2012.
Her work has featured in publications including: Elle Decoration, Selvedge and Ghost of Gone Birds.
Maxine will bring her flock of paper sparrows to the Clocktower on the first weekend of the Festival and afterwards open her home studio on Tor Close.
